Gov. Tony Evers signed SB 23, now 2025 Wisconsin Act 102 on Wednesday, officially making Wisconsin the 49th state to provide a year of coverage for postpartum mothers on Medicaid.

“It’s been a long time coming, but I’m darn proud we got it done,” Evers, who signed the bill at Children’s Hospital in Milwaukee, said in a statement.
